CNMC Goldmine shares see brisk trade after stop-work order
Published Fri, Jul 22, 2016 · 09:50 PM
Singapore
SHARES of Catalist-listed CNMC Goldmine Holdings were among the most hotly traded on Friday, following the notification by the Kelantan State Lands and Mines Office for it to temporarily stop its operations at the Sokor gold field.
The stock dipped to a day's low of 36 Singapore cents in early trade and rose to a high of 45 Singapore cents.
